WebMay 31, 2016 · When PowerShell is called with the -Command parameter, all following arguments are joined to a single command (like $args -join " " ). This command is then executed. -Command is the default parameter: If a Parameter does not start with - or /, powershell behaves, as if -Command were present before. This:

WebFeb 23, 2024 · Passing -c "" to the shell runs those commands in the WSL shell Given that, you can pretty much run any Linux command (s) from Windows Python. For multiple commands: Either separate them with a semicolon. E.g.: os.system ('wsl ~ -e sh -c "ls -l > filelist.txt; gzip filelist.txt') WebNov 29, 2012 · The best option I can think of as of now is to use PowerShell for Window Remote Management. Below is how to execute a command in remote PC using PowerShell and how to execute the same in Python. PowerShell to start a service: Get-Service -ComputerName aaa0001 -Name Tomcat9 Start-Service.

WebJan 18, 2024 · For any shell in any operating system there are three types of commands: Shell language keywords are part of the shell's scripting language. Examples of bash keywords include: if, then, else, elif, and fi. Examples of cmd.exe keywords include: dir, copy, move, if, and echo. Examples of PowerShell keywords include: for, foreach, try, …
